Main features and details

The primary feature of No Deposit Bonuses is that they provide players with a risk-free opportunity to explore a casino’s offerings. Typically, these bonuses can take the form of free cash or free spins on selected slot games. Players can use these bonuses to test various games, assess the quality of the casino’s software, and evaluate the overall gaming experience. However, it is crucial to pay attention to the terms associated with these bonuses. Common components include:

  • Wagering Requirements: This refers to the number of times a player must wager the bonus amount before they can withdraw any winnings. For example, if a player receives a $10 bonus with a 30x wagering requirement, they must wager $300 before cashing out.
  • Eligible Games: Not all games contribute equally towards meeting wagering requirements. Often, slot games contribute 100%, while table games may contribute less or not at all.
  • Expiration Dates: Bonuses typically come with a time limit, after which they expire. Players must be aware of these deadlines to avoid losing their bonuses.

Advantages and disadvantages

While No Deposit Bonuses offer several advantages, they also come with certain drawbacks that players must consider. The advantages include:

  • Risk-Free Exploration: Players can try out new casinos and games without financial risk.
  • Potential for Real Winnings: Players can win real money without making a deposit.
  • Increased Engagement: These bonuses can enhance the overall gaming experience and keep players engaged.

On the other hand, the disadvantages include:

  • Wagering Requirements: High wagering requirements can make it challenging to withdraw winnings.
  • Limited Game Selection: Some bonuses may only apply to specific games, limiting player choice.
  • Expiration Dates: Players may lose bonuses if they do not meet the requirements in time.
